One popular option for homeowners looking to upgrade their windows is to invest in energy-efficient windows Energy-efficient windows are designed to reduce heat loss and gain, which can help keep your home more comfortable year-round and lower your energy bills These windows are typically double-paned and feature low-emissivity coatings that reflect infrared light while allowing visible light to pass through Some energy-efficient windows also have insulating gas fills between the panes for added insulation.
In addition to energy efficiency, another important factor to consider when choosing new windows is maintenance Some window materials, like wood, require regular painting and sealing to prevent water damage and rot On the other hand, vinyl and fiberglass windows are low-maintenance options that can withstand the elements without the need for frequent upkeep home for windows.
